Merge pull request #81589 from sadlil/master

Fix Test for kubeadm/app/util/net.GetHostname
This commit is contained in:
Kubernetes Prow Robot 2019-08-19 10:11:44 -07:00 committed by GitHub
commit f4521bf5a2
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-19,6 +19,7 @@ package util
import ( import (
"errors" "errors"
"os" "os"
"strings"
"testing" "testing"
) )
@ -37,6 +38,12 @@ func TestGetHostname(t *testing.T) {
result: "overridden", result: "overridden",
expectedErr: nil, expectedErr: nil,
}, },
{
desc: "overridden hostname uppercase",
hostname: "OVERRIDDEN",
result: "overridden",
expectedErr: nil,
},
{ {
desc: "hostname contains only spaces", desc: "hostname contains only spaces",
hostname: " ", hostname: " ",
@ -46,7 +53,7 @@ func TestGetHostname(t *testing.T) {
{ {
desc: "empty parameter", desc: "empty parameter",
hostname: "", hostname: "",
result: hostname, result: strings.ToLower(hostname),
expectedErr: err, expectedErr: err,
}, },
} }